What Is a Blockchain Fork? Understanding the Key Concepts

·

Blockchain forks are pivotal events in cryptocurrency networks that shape their evolution. To grasp this concept, we must first understand blockchain fundamentals.

How Blockchain Technology Works

A blockchain is a decentralized peer-to-peer network of computers that:

In Ethereum Classic (ETC), the blockchain extends beyond simple transactions by supporting smart contracts—self-executing programs that automate financial agreements.

The Mining Process Explained

Blockchains operate through consensus mechanisms like Proof-of-Work (PoW):

  1. Miners compete to solve complex cryptographic puzzles
  2. Successful miners create new blocks containing transactions
  3. The network validates and adds verified blocks to the chain
  4. Miners receive rewards for their computational work

This process occurs every:

The Rules Governing Blockchains

For global decentralized networks to function cohesively, all participants must follow identical protocol rules covering:

These rules are encoded in software clients like:

Maintaining Network Consensus

When all nodes run compatible clients with identical rules:

Even minor deviations in protocol rules can cause network partitions called forks.

Types of Blockchain Forks

Forks generally fall into two categories:

  1. Soft Forks

    • Backward-compatible protocol updates
    • Non-upgraded nodes can still participate
  2. Hard Forks

    • Non-backward-compatible changes
    • Creates a permanent divergence
    • Requires all nodes to upgrade

The Forking Process Explained

Implementing protocol changes requires careful coordination:

  1. Community debates proposed changes
  2. Developers implement approved changes
  3. Node operators upgrade their software
  4. The network transitions to new rules

Major blockchains use formal improvement processes:

Notable Blockchain Forks in History

The Ethereum/ETC Split (2016)

👉 Learn more about Ethereum Classic's principles

Bitcoin Cash Fork (2017)

Evaluating Fork Viability

Successful forks require:

Less viable forks often fail due to:

Frequently Asked Questions

Q: Can blockchain forks be reversed?

A: No—forks create permanent divergences. However, unsuccessful forks may be abandoned by their communities.

Q: Do fork participants receive new coins?

A: In asset-diverging hard forks, holders typically receive coins on both chains at the time of forking.

Q: How often do major forks occur?

A: There's no set schedule—forks happen when fundamental protocol changes are proposed and gain substantial support.

👉 Discover how blockchains evolve through consensus

Q: What determines a fork's success?

A: Key factors include community size, developer activity, mining participation, and market adoption.

The Philosophical Significance of Forking

Blockchain forks represent more than technical events—they embody the decentralized ethos of cryptocurrency by:

As the blockchain space matures, forks will continue serving as a mechanism for reconciling differing visions while maintaining the fundamental principles of decentralization and user sovereignty.